C语言中变量说明语句中依次可指定变量的哪些信息?

如题所述

在 C 语言中,变量说明语句用于声明变量并指定其类型和名称等信息。变量说明语句可以包含以下信息:

1. 变量的类型:指定变量的数据类型,例如 int、float、double 等。

2. 变量的名称:指定变量的标识符,即变量名。

3. 变量的初值:可选项,为变量指定一个初始值,例如 int x = 10;。

4. 存储类型:可选项,指定变量的存储类型,包括自动存储类型(auto)、静态存储类型(static)、寄存器存储类型(register)和外部存储类型(extern)等。

变量说明语句通常具有以下格式:

```c
type-specifier declarator [= initializer];
```

其中,type-specifier 表示变量的类型,declarator 表示变量的名称和其他附加信息,initializer 表示变量的初值。

例如,以下是一个定义整型变量 x 的变量说明语句:

```c
int x;
```

这个语句指定了变量的类型为 int、名称为 x,并且使用了默认的自动存储类型(因为未指定存储类型)。如果需要为变量赋初始值,可以使用以下形式的变量说明语句:

```c
int x = 10;
```

这个语句将整数变量 x 的初始值设置为 10。
温馨提示:答案为网友推荐,仅供参考

相关了解……

你可能感兴趣的内容

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 非常风气网